Regional Risk Factors for Basement Water and Mold Issues

Your basement’s vulnerability to moisture and mold stems from Southwest Ohio’s clay-heavy soil, which traps water against foundation walls and creates damaging hydrostatic pressure. The region’s seasonal storms and high humidity levels compound these risks, especially in older homes built without modern waterproofing systems like vapor barriers or perimeter drainage. Foundation cracks from freeze-thaw cycles and inadequate ventilation further increase your home’s susceptibility to water intrusion and subsequent mold growth.

Best Practices for Preventing Basement Mold and Moisture Damage

To protect your basement from Southwest Ohio’s moisture challenges, you’ll need a multi-layered defense strategy that starts outside your home. Maintain proper grading that directs water away from your foundation, install reliable sump pumps, and immediately seal any foundation cracks you discover. Indoor tactics should include using dehumidifiers to keep relative humidity below 60%, scheduling annual professional inspections, improving ventilation, and considering hydrophobic wall coatings for added protection.
